What's The Definition Of Tempest-tost?
[adj] pounded or hit repeatedly by storms or adversities
Synonyms | Synonyms for Tempest-tost: buffeted | storm-tossed | tempest-swept | tempest-tossed | troubled Related Terms | Find terms related to Tempest-tost: See Also | |
